Yellow-browed Warbler. Sand Point 28th October 2006Not an easy bird to photograph. This was my fourth attempt. Dull conditions meant pushing the iso up to 1000 in order to get a fast enough shutter speed. Tracking the bird was a little easier than the Two-barred Greenish Warbler mainly due to the practice. The bird could only be photographed in manual focus as the leaves were causing problems. Unfortunately I formatted the memory card so have no camera settings. Nikon D200, Nikon 600mm f4, ISO 1000 |
